We will evacuate students in China if it becomes necessary – Nana Addo

President of the Republic of Ghana,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o Addo, has extended his sympathy to China over the outbreak of the global epidemic, Coronavirus.
Death toll for the coronavirus has reportedly risen to 2000.
Health officials say the new  virus is a family of viruses that include the common cold, and viruses such as SARS and MERS.
Coronaviruses are common in many different species of animals, including camels and bats. Rarely, these coronaviruses can evolve and infect humans and then spread between humans, recent examples of this include SARS-CoV and MERS-CoV.
Until 2019 most coronaviruses infect animals, but not people.
Delivering the fourth State of The Nation Address on the floor of Parliament, President of the Republic of Ghana,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o Addo, stated wished the Chinese government well it deals with the outbreak of Coronavirus.
He stated that government has not ruled out the option of repatriating Ghanaian students from Wuhan due to the outbreak of Coronavirus and that if it becomes necessary, these students will be evacuated.
Former President of the National Union of Ghana Students in China, Philip Arthur, earlier stated that students in China need evacuation from China and not money.
This comes after government, in a statement, said it has released money to be disbursed to Ghanaian students in China.
“The government is being insensitive, we are calling for evacuation and you are sending us money, how good is money to a dying soul. Even if the monies get to the students by what means are you transporting yourself to town since transport systems are not working in China, this is what we are talking about, we are talking about safety. We are not in need of money” he fumed.
